The People of the State of New York, Respondent, v. George Garcia, Defendant-Appellant. Ind. No. 2648/17 Case No. 2019-02070
Unpublished Opinion
MOTION DECISION
Present - Hon. Judith J. Gische, Justice Presiding, Cynthia S. Kern Jeffrey K. Oing Saliann Scarpulla Martin Shulman, Justices.
Appeals having been taken to this Court from a judgment of the Supreme Court, New York County, rendered on or about January 04, 2019, and from an order, same Court, entered on or about August 10, 2020, which order denied defendant's motion to vacate his sentence (see, Certificate Granting Leave, M-2808, entered September 29, 2020), And defendant-appellant having moved for an order continuing the stay of execution of judgment and bail pending the appeal, originally granted by an order of the Supreme Court, New York County, entered on or about October 08, 2020, and continued by orders of this Court, entered on January 12, 2021 (M-2020-03832) and March 02, 2021 (M-2021-00208), on condition the consolidated appeals are perfected within 180 days from the filing of the record, Now, upon reading and filing the papers with respect to the motion, and due deliberation having been had thereon, It is ordered that the motion is granted to the extent of continuing the stay of execution of sentence and bail pending appeal, on the same terms and conditions, and upon the further condition that the consolidated appeals are perfected for the January 2022 Term of this Court, with leave to seek further extensions, if so advised.
